  • Funky Trees! 3.2 years ago

    @BittyJupiter360 With the hinge rotator set to the range you want (example: 90°), on overload mod, set your minimum output to 0, and keep maximum output as 1, or -1, depending on which direction you want it to go. For input, type in Activate2.

  • XF-300-A1 StarHawk 3.2 years ago

    @IceCraftGaming I've come to figure out that, in terms of control rates, you always want it to be below 1. The lower the number, the less automatic control it has over how you fly your aircraft. Too high of a number means you will hardly be able to control it at all.
